10 Clever Uses of Baking Soda in the Garden

Baking soda isn’t just for baking! It’s a versatile, eco-friendly solution that can help improve various aspects of your garden. Here are 10 clever uses for baking soda to keep your plants healthy and your gardening tasks easier:

Natural Fungicide
Combat fungal diseases like powdery mildew by mixing baking soda with water and a little liquid soap. Spray the mixture on your plants for a natural solution.

Weed Killer
Apply baking soda directly on garden weeds to kill them. This method is a safe alternative to chemical weed killers, ensuring surrounding plants stay unharmed.

Pest Deterrent
Mix baking soda and flour, then dust the mixture onto your plants. This combination can help deter pests like cabbage worms and aphids.
